Abstract
Three-phase inverters are currently utilized in an enormous variety of industrial applications, including variable-speed ac drives. However, due to their complexity and exposure to several stresses, they are prone to suffer critical failures. Accordingly, this paper presents a novel diagnostic algorithm that allows the real-time detection and localization of multiple power switch open-circuit faults in inverter-fed ac motor drives. The proposed method is quite simple and just requires the measured motor phase currents and their corresponding reference signals, already available from the main control system, therefore avoiding the use of additional sensors and hardware. Several experimental results using a vector-controlled permanent-magnet synchronous motor drive are presented, showing the diagnostic algorithm effectiveness, its relatively fast detection time, and its robustness against false alarms.
